WTC Standings: India Slip To Fourth, England Jump To THIS Spot After Lord’s Thriller

WTC Standings: India Slip To Fourth, England Jump To THIS Spot After Lord’s Thriller

Zee News

Published

The thrilling Lord's Test between India and England had immediate implications on the World Test Championship (WTC) standings.  

Full Article